After entering the house, the couple went into the parlour to retrieve their keys. Susan had just leaned over to grab them, when a cold breeze blew through the room and she felt a cool touch on her face. Susan was about to comment on the icy sensation, when Emma appeared standing before them, one hand lightly resting against her cheek, while smiling with an expression of immense gratitude brightening her face.

Just then another gentle breeze of cold air blew by the couple and the spirit of Jebediah walked past them to stand next to Emma, casually wrapping an arm around her waist. He smiled at the young couple and looking them over, took in all the injuries they had sustained over the past few days. Smiling he extended his hand to Justin and shook it, then taking Susan’s uninjured hand he kissed the back of it and bowed his head slightly in her direction.

Stepping back, he allowed the other spirit to move forward. Emma leaned in and placed one hand on each of Justin’s cheeks. Noticing his wary expression, she smiled at him, then closed her eyes, and he was overcome by a warm sensation of fullness. When she opened her eyes, all of Justin’s wounds and burns were healed. Next, she moved to Susan, and with a benevolent smile worthy of any heavenly angel, she kissed both of her cheeks and, like Justin, Susan’s injuries were completely healed.

Emma stepped back and once again joined Jebediah. Together, they continued to back away, smiling their love and appreciation to Justin and Susan for freeing them after so long. As they slowly moved into a bank of rolling fog, they faded away.

Justin looked down at his completely healed body and grabbed his wife, lifted her into the air and spun her around “Well, damn baby, this story will make one hell of a paper.” He sat her down and looked into her smiling, happy face, and added, “If anyone will believe it.”

The End
